Police have reportedly made an arrest in connection with a hit-and-run accident that resulted in the death of a woman. The accident happened during the evening hours on Maui. According to reports, a motorcycle traveling southbound hit a rock in the road, causing the motorcycle’s passenger to fall off.
Reports say a vehicle then collided with the victim and fled the scene, failing to stop and render aid. The motorcycle passenger was pronounced dead at the scene, authorities said. The driver of the motorcycle was not injured. Reportedly, the driver who fled turned herself in after police seized the vehicle. She was arrested and faces very serious charges.
